Transaction cd0dfac6cf65877bde849e9de660f0004ec3c1662006a48c66d1f19dd8e9af73
1 Input
1 Output
-
cd0dfac6cf65877bde849e9de660f0004ec3c1662006a48c66d1f19dd8e9af73:0
- value
- 576830
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 01789ed581a07ec4c6a900e1bdda52c653902563 OP_EQUAL
- address
- 31po6bEZFT2MsyjfeksBX5QG8q7BABwL4R